2000 AD – 1995-1996 – Spoiler alerts The pit is where Megacity One’s worst Judges are sent, a beat for the cops who are not very good at their job. Judge Dredd is sent there to offer training and evaluation and to see if any of them deserve a second chance. Though he finds some incompetent inept judge-cops, he finds most of them are quite good police officers trapped there by police corruption. With assistance from misfit cops who prove themselves highly worthy, Dredd helps bring down the judges responsible for serious corruption. Sadly, his investigations also lead to the exposure of two cops who are having a forbidden love affair together. While Dredd feels sympathy for them, the law is the law. A well- handled interconnected thread of different story strands. Arthur Chappell
